Output 66364d6f1ecda626a64d5472a5ad12c192828d3325ae295b48fd7a2a6714437b:0

value
34399995540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fdc3f69a055adb1d5bb66d8b00225fc6457ab86 OP_EQUAL
address
3GGHD88CuxBmgEZxV4H9VVRGVhMQGZauzx
transaction
66364d6f1ecda626a64d5472a5ad12c192828d3325ae295b48fd7a2a6714437b